Welcome to the beautiful cruise port of Kralendijk, Bonaire! Join us on our winter 2025 cruise aboard the Holland America Eurodam as we show you exactly how to explore this colorful Dutch Caribbean town without booking an expensive cruise excursion. In this walking tour, we break down local taxi rates, the STINAPA Nature Fee you MUST know about, and how to get to spots like Klein Bonaire and Fort Oranje. What You'll See & Learn in This Video: * How to navigate the Kralendijk port area right off the gangway. * Local taxi and water taxi prices to the best beaches. * How to pay the mandatory STINAPA Nature Fee for water activities. * Dutch Colonial architecture and historic sites. * Why the water right next to the cruise pier is crystal clear Destination / Service Cost (USD) Details Eden Beach Taxi: $15 each way For a group of up to 4 people Sorobon Beach Taxi: $5 per person Quick ride from the port area Klein Bonaire Water Taxi: $25 round trip Departs Karel's Beach Bar STINAPA Nature Fee: $40 Mandatory for water entry (Free 13 & under) Important Cruiser Tip: Bonaire's waters are highly protected marine parks. If you plan to swim, snorkel, or visit Klein Bonaire, you must pay the STINAPA Nature fee online before entering the water! Have you been to Bonaire, or are you planning a cruise here soon?
